** The Honda repair market serving Littleton, NC, is characteristic of a rural-to-suburban region. There are no dedicated, Honda-exclusive performance shops or specialty tuning garages within the town limits itself. The market consists primarily of competent, general independent repair shops, with a few standouts (like those listed above) that have developed a strong reputation for handling the intricacies of Honda and other Japanese brands. **Competition Level:** Moderate. While there are numerous general mechanics, the number of shops with proven, review-backed expertise in advanced Honda systems (like VTEC, CVTs, and hybrid systems) is more limited. This creates an opportunity for the top-rated specialists in nearby commercial centers. **Average Quality:** The average quality for routine maintenance (oil changes, brakes) is good. For advanced diagnostics and repair, the quality is highly dependent on choosing one of the more reputable shops with specific relevant experience.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is generally more affordable than dealership labor rates but aligns with standard independent shop rates in North Carolina. Expect to pay **$100 - $130 per hour** for labor at the top-tier shops. Parts pricing is typically competitive, and these shops often use high-quality aftermarket or OEM parts.

In our area, we frequently address air conditioning compressor failures and premature brake wear. Littleton's hot, humid summers strain AC systems, while rural and highway driving around Lake Gaston leads to more frequent braking and dust accumulation.
Look for shops in Littleton or nearby Roanoke Rapids that are ASE-certified and advertise Honda or Japanese vehicle expertise. Check for online reviews from local customers and ask if they use genuine Honda parts or high-quality equivalents for repairs.
Generally, independent repair shops in Littleton offer more competitive labor rates than the nearest Honda dealerships, which are a significant drive away. You can save on service costs while still receiving quality parts and expert care for models like the Civic, CR-V, and Accord.
Seek service immediately for flashing warning lights (like check engine or VSA) indicating an urgent issue. For the maintenance minder, schedule service at a local shop when it appears to avoid a long trip to a distant dealership and to maintain your vehicle's warranty-compliant service history.
Frequent travel on NC-4, NC-48, and rural roads near Lake Gaston means more exposure to dust, potholes, and seasonal pollen. We recommend more frequent cabin air filter changes, tire rotations, and suspension checks than the standard schedule to account for these conditions.
